Subject: Key rotation for Spindlecrest render service

Team — as discussed at sync, we rotated the Spindlecrest credential after last week's template rendering regression, since the old key was baked into the slow benchmark harness. Old key dies Friday. Update your local profiling configs before then. The replacement key for internal use is below.

gateway credential: qvz2-6w

# Wiki Environments & Access — Pagewright

Quick orientation for whoever inherits this. Pagewright (our internal wiki) runs three environments: sandbox, staging, and live. Role-based access is enforced at the space level — editors, reviewers, and space-admins map to groups synced nightly from the Dellbrook directory. Staging mirrors live roles but with a test group overlay, so don't panic if permissions look weird there. Sandbox is a free-for-all on purpose. Each environment reads its role mappings from the values shown below.

service settings:
PRAIX_LOG_LEVEL=error
PRAIX_METRICS_HOST=metrics.praix.qorvelcorp.corp
PRAIX_POOL_SIZE=16

## Matching Service Environments

Pairwell's matcher runs hot in staging and production; GC pauses above 400ms trip the health probe and drain the node. We tuned heap sizing per environment after the March incident. Release managers should not promote a build until pause metrics settle. Each environment applies the following runtime values.

settings of yaguf-fajof:
[druvan]
host = druvan.plorvatech.example
user = druvan_svc
database = druvan_prod